Police Arrest Couple in Torrevieja and Alicante for Smartphone Theft and Fraud Over €2,000
In a recent operation,the National Police arrested a man and a woman suspected of stealing a mobile phone and using it to commit fraud amounting to over 2,000 euros. The two suspects were detained in the cities of Torrevieja and Alicante after authorities pieced together their method of operation and tracked their movements.
How the Crime unfolded
the suspects closely followed their victim and seized the possibility when the individual was distracted, actively using their mobile phone. The aim was to steal the phone while it was unlocked, switched on, and accessed to personal and banking facts, making it easier to commit fraud.

Tips to Protect Your Mobile Devices and Personal Data
- Always lock your phone with a PIN, fingerprint, or face recognition.
- Avoid using your phone in crowded or unfamiliar areas where you can be easily distracted.
- Enable remote tracking and wiping features to protect your data if the device is lost or stolen.
- Be cautious about sharing personal or banking information thru apps and websites.
- Report any suspicious activity or theft promptly to the authorities.
